### Black Bean and Sweet Potato Quesadillas Recipe
#### Ingredients:
- 4 large tortillas (corn or flour)
- 1 cup of canned black be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 small sweet potato, peeled and grated
- 1/2 cup finely chopped onions
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1/2 teaspoon chili powder (optional)
- Salt to taste
- 1/4 cup sh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
#### Instructions:
1. **Prepare the Ingredients:**
- Peel and grate the sweet potato. Rinse it well under cold water to remove excess starch.
- Drain and rinse the black beans, then pat dry with a clean kitchen towel.
2. **Cook the Sweet Potato:**
-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a medium skillet over medium heat.
- Add the grated sweet potato and sauté for about 5-7 minutes until tender and slightly browned.
- Remove from the pan and let it cool slightly.
3. **Combine Ingredients:**
- In a large bowl, combine the cooked sweet potato with the black beans, chopped onions, cumin, chili powder (if using), and a pinch of salt.
- Mix well until all ingredients are evenly distributed.
4. **Assemble Quesadillas:**
- Place one tortilla on a clean work surface.
- Spread half of the bean mixture onto the tortilla, leaving about 1 inch around the edges.
- Sprinkle shredded cheese over the bean mixture.
5. **Fold and Cook:**
- Top with another tortilla, pressing gently to spread the filling and cheese evenly.
- Heat a large non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at.
- Place the quesadilla in the hot pan and cook for about 2-3 minutes on each side until the tortillas are crispy and golden brown.
6. **Serve:**
- Cut the cooked quesadilla into wedges using a sharp knife.
- Serve warm with your favorite toppings such as sour cream, guacamole, or salsa.
#### Tips:
- For extra flavor, marinate the sweet potato and black beans for 30 minutes before cooking.
- Feel free to add other vegetables like bell peppers or corn according to your taste preferences.
- If using a gas stove, preheat the griddle to ensure even cooking of the quesadillas.
